What is the meaning of unshared electrons?

What is the meaning of unshared electrons?

Unshared electrons refer to outer (valence) electrons not part of a covalent bond. Shared electrons are those participating in a bond. Subtract the number of shared electrons (bonds x 2) from the number of valence electrons to discover number of unshared electrons.

What is the difference between a lone pair and an electron pair?

Every elements have electrons in their atoms. The electron pairs can be found in two types as bond pair and lone pair. The main difference between bond pair and lone pair is that bond pair is composed of two electrons that are in a bond whereas lone pair is composed of two electrons that are not in a bond.

What is lone pair and bond pair with example?

The electrons present in the covalent bond are known as bond pair of electrons. For example, in methane, there are four C-H covalent bonds. Thus, in methane molecule, four bond pairs of electrons are present. The electron pairs left in the valence shell without forming the bond are known as lone pairs of electrons.

What is meant by shielding of electrons in an atom?

Electron shielding refers to the blocking of valence shell electron attraction by the nucleus due to the presence of inner-shell electrons. Electrons in an s orbital can shield p electrons at the same energy level because of the spherical shape of the s orbital.

How do you find the lone pair of electrons?

To identify lone pairs in a molecule, figure out the number of valence electrons of the atom and subtract the number of electrons that have participated in the bonding.

Where are lone pairs found in an atom?

A lone pair in chemistry refers to a pair of valence electrons that in a covalent bond are not exchanged with another atom and is often called an unshared pair or non-bonding pair. In the outermost electron shell of atoms, lone pairs are found. By using a Lewis structure, they can be defined.
